Tour Itinerary:
Day 1: Transfer from Nairobi to Mountain Rock where we set camp. While here you have the Options for horse riding, fishing and forest natural history walk in afternoon at an extra cost. At 2,000m this is the point at which acclimatization takes place. Day 2: We board our vehicles after an early breakfast and drive to Sirimon Park gate where you start your trek from. Trek up through magnificent virgin forests, bamboo and giant heather zones before reaching the high altitude moorland and our first hut, “Old Moses” at 3,340m. This first day’s gentle trek takes 3-4 hours and climbs 690m. Day 3: Up the spectacular Mackinder Valley past strange giant groundsel and lobelia plants to emerge onto what looks like a set from Star Trek - Shipton’s Camp at 4,236m. A surreal setting below the towering peaks and glaciers, with its resident population of bizarre rock hyrax. Day 4: Early start to reach Pt Lenana at 4,895m for sunrise. The climb starts on frozen scree and continues on a rocky track with some very minor scrambling. With a good moon you barely need a torch. Without a moon, then the pollution-free sky, bang on the equator, gives you as good a view of the stars as almost anywhere on Earth. The climb takes between 3 and 5 hours and to add to the exhilaration Kilimanjaro is usually visible on the horizon. A further 3 hours down to camp by Hall Tarns in the magnificent Gorges Valley for breakfast then a further gentle descent down the Gorges Valley past spectacular chasms, waterfalls and weirdly eroded lava flows to hot showers and log fires in Mt. Kenya huts. Wildlife viewing in evening - often from your cabin window as the elephant and buffalo graze outside! Day 5: Descent on a broad track through bamboo and virgin rain forest to meet vehicles for the return to Nairobi – usually arriving mid to late afternoon. Notes:
